The Evolution Of PC Gaming

PC gaming didn’t just pop up overnight: it emerged from humble beginnings.
Key Milestones In PC Gaming History
From its inception in the late 1970s with games like Spacewar., through the golden age of the 90s with classics such as Doom and StarCraft, every decade has added its own flavor. Wolfenstein 3D pushed the boundaries of, well, walls. Fast-forward, and the dawn of 3D graphics unleashed titans like Half-Life and Quake. They didn’t just change how games looked: they revolutionized how players interacted with virtual worlds.
Impact Of Hardware Advancements
And let’s not forget about hardware. The evolution of CPUs, GPUs, and RAM has accelerated more than a caffeine-fueled speedrun. As graphics cards went from 256k memory to multi-gigabyte powerhouses, games transformed into sprawling realities. These advancements didn’t just enhance visuals: they allowed developers to craft complex, immersive narratives that keep gamers engaged for hours (and let’s be real, sometimes days.).

The Rise Of Indie Games
One of the most exciting phenomena is the rise of indie games. Titles like Hollow Knight and Celeste emerge from small teams with boundless creativity. They prove that you don’t need a billion-dollar budget to create art: you just need passion and maybe a pet cat or two for inspiration. Indie developers are challenging mainstream norms, reminding everyone that creativity can thrive outside the big studios.

Custom Builds vs. Pre-Built Systems
Then, there’s the debate: custom builds versus pre-built systems. Custom builds let you feel like a wizard assembling your own concoction. But, pre-built systems often come with warranties and make life infinitely easier, especially if you’re more into button-mashing than DIY. It’s all about finding that balance between convenience and personalized power.

Popular Game Distribution Services
Steam, Epic Games Store, and Origin have transformed how players access games. Gone are the days of hunting for physical copies in stores: now, with a few clicks, entire libraries are just a download away. Steam regularly hosts sales that can lead to impulse buys on games one might never have considered otherwise.
